did you extend it at all???
on the website it says 10hp- is that reccomended or maximum???
and can you tube/wakeoar???
do you know how fast it would go with a 8-10
ThePonyLonely 1 year ago
@ThePonyLonely we left the length the stardard 10ft long not sure about what they say but we have a 15hp outboard 2stroke and it goes perfect, it could handle some more power but would depend how well u have set up the keel to stop it sliding as well as the stresses involved. yerr u can wakboard but it is a small boat so it is affected somewhat, so u dont wont anyone to big. we can get it up to 25mph with our 15hp

Did you put fiberglass over it?
91yotapick 1 year ago
@91yotapick Yes, but we only put fibreglass strips over the places where we had joined the wood together. the rest we just gave a good layering of varnish
